I'm just getting started installing WordPress locally so I can work on it before sending it to live, and I just wanted to know how can I backup everything locally once I start working on it.
I need it to be backed up completely with the root folder, databases, and whatever else it needs for a full backup.
But I'm using Microsoft web platform installer to install everything
You can use phpMyAdmin to backup your database, just go to the export tab and select all tables.
As for your files, zip up the public_html (may be named something else, possibly httpdocs) folder and download it.
